Why Most MSMEs Struggle After Year Three and How to Avoid It

Most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) in Nigeria start with strong energy. There is usually a clear idea, some seed capital, and a market to serve. But the real test comes after the first two or three years. At that point, many MSMEs hit a wall. Growth stalls, expenses creep up, and the business starts to feel stuck.
